Unconfigured Ad Widget

Collapse

Anúncio

Collapse
No announcement yet.

Algoritmo em JAVA

Collapse
X
 
  • Filter
  • Tempo
  • Show
Clear All
new posts

  • Font Size
    #1

    Duvida Algoritmo em JAVA

    Oi pessoal estou com uma pequena duvida na construção de um algoritmo. Vejam.

    Elabore um algoritmo para receber o valor do produto em dolar e a cotação do dolar, mostre o valor em real.


    package exemplo6;
    import java.util.Scanner;

    public class Main {


    public static void main(String[] args) {
    Scanner Ler=new Scanner(System.in);

    double vpdolar=0, cotacao=0, real=0;

    System.out.println("Digite o valor do produto em dolar: ");
    vpdolar=Ler.nextDouble();
    System.out.println("Digite o valor da cotação: ");
    cotacao=Ler.nextDouble();

    real= vpdolar*cotacao;
    System.out.println("O valor em real é: "+ real);
    }

    }

    Fiz. Mais acho que minha logica não está correta.
    Alguem pode me ajudar;
    Não troco o meu "oxente" pelo "ok" de ninguém !
    (Ariano Suassuna)

    Se ajudei agradeça!



  • Font Size
    #2
    Resposta..

    Qual a sua dúvida? Escrevi a classe abaixo com as descrições que você citou. Dê uma olhada, fiz usando a classe Swing invés da Scanner.

    import javax.swing.*;

    public class Conversao
    {
    public static void main(String[] args)
    {
    //declaração das variaveis
    double valorProduto, valorDolar, conversao;

    //Entrada dos dados atraves do metodo Input da classe Swing, convertendo já o valor da string para Double
    valorProduto = Double.parseDouble(JOptionPane.showInputDialog("En tre com o valor do produto"));
    valorDolar = Double.parseDouble(JOptionPane.showInputDialog("En tre com o valor do dolar"));

    //calculo do valor do produto e do valor do dolar;
    conversao = valorProduto*valorDolar;

    //tela de demonstração dos resultado
    JOptionPane.showMessageDialog(null, "Valor do produto em Dolar: $"+valorProduto+ "\n"
    +"Valor da cotação do Dolar: $"+valorDolar+ "\n"
    +"Valor do produto em Reais: R$"+conversao);
    }
    }

    Qualquer dúvida estamos ai
    Abraços
    Wellington Fernandes
    MSN/Email: wellingtonfrs@hotmail.com

    Comment


    • Font Size
      #3
      Desculpem mas eu acho que a conversão esta errada. Quer dizer
      Código:
      1$   ------- cotacão
      valor ------- X
      logo teriamos
      Código:
      X=(valor*cotação)/1;
      que poderia ser escrito para
      Código:
      X=(valor*cotação);
      Por exemplo (partindo do principio que 1$ equivale a 1.5R):
      Código:
        1$   --- 1.5R
        10$ --- X
      
        X=10*1.5
        X=15
      Espero ter ajudado.
      “Finalmente encontrei um inimigo digno de mim e uma jornada em que preciso desenvolver toda a minha coragem, pois temos de combater homens bravos e monstruosas feras.”, Alexandre, o Grande.

      Comment


      • Font Size
        #4
        NAAAOOOOOOO
        Falei asneiras. Esta correcto. Não dormi nada hj e estou a milhas. Desculpe.
        “Finalmente encontrei um inimigo digno de mim e uma jornada em que preciso desenvolver toda a minha coragem, pois temos de combater homens bravos e monstruosas feras.”, Alexandre, o Grande.

        Comment


        • Font Size
          #5
          Esta perfeito! vai ajudar o cara.

          Comment

          X
          Working...
          X